The purpose of an ejector pin is to apply a force to eject a part from the mold. In some cases this process can leave surface marks known as read-through or pin push. To avoid this the goal of the designer is to position the pins to minimize cosmetic witness marks on your finished parts. The injection molding process is widely used in various industries, including automotive, electronics, packaging, and medical. As these industries continue to grow and evolve, the demand for ejector pins used in injection molding processes is expected to increase. Injection molding offers high production efficiency and cost-effectiveness, thereby driving the demand for ejector pins. Continuous advancements in material technology have led to the development of high-quality ejector pin materials. Manufacturers are now using materials with increased hardness, wear resistance, and thermal stability to improve the performance and lifespan of ejector pins. These advancements in material technology contribute to the growth of the ejector pins market. There is a growing emphasis on molding precision and quality in industries such as automotive and electronics, where dimensional accuracy and surface finish are critical. Ejector pins play a vital role in achieving precise ejection of molded parts, ensuring dimensional accuracy and quality. As industries prioritize these factors, the demand for high-precision ejector pins is expected to rise.
